Since 1987, September has been marked as Library Card Sign Up Month to celebrate the beginning of the school year and show how vital libraries and schools working together is for their communities. Normally, the Library would celebrate that toward the beginning of the month with a party of sorts to sign students up for library cards. This event has always been promoted and attended by Councilman Ernest Brooks and planned by Angela Parks. The library would like to thank them both very much for doing so years’ past.

This year, JMC Library is proud to announce that we have been working on a partnership with the Jackson-Madison County School System.

Sora, the Student Reading App, is an app that many schools have started using to allow their students to access materials at home, on their own devices. JMC School System has prepared Sora for student use, which will allow them to access age-appropriate items that the library has on Overdrive, at no charge to the school system. Students will be able to use their student IDs to access over 28,000 items for free.

This service is ready to use starting immediately, with more plans in development. In the future, the library and school system plan to extend this partnership to allow students to checkout physical materials from the library with their Student ID. We are also discussing the possibility of a courier service to deliver library books to the schools for students who may not be able to make the trip to the library. This way, every child within the Jackson-Madison County School system will have a card of their own with no hassle.

Both JMC Library and JMC Schools are thrilled to announce this partnership and make it known to students and the community as a whole.
